Glycine transporters
Glycine transporters (GlyTs) are members of the Na+/Cl--dependent transporter family, whose activities and subcellular distributions are regulated by phosphorylation and interactions with other proteins. GlyTs comprise glycine transporter type 1 (SLC6A9; GlyT1) and glycine transporter type 2 (SLC6A5; Glyt2). Both GlyTs exist in multiple splice variants. GlyTs that regulate levels of brain glycine, an inhibitory neurotransmitter with co-agonist activity for NMDA receptors (NMDARs), have been considered to be important targets for the treatment of brain disorders with suppressed NMDAR function such as schizophrenia.
GlyT1 and GlyT2 are expressed on both astrocytes and neurons, but their expression pattern in brain tissue is foremost related to neurotransmission. GlyT2 is markedly expressed in brainstem, spinal cord and cerebellum, where it is responsible for glycine uptake into glycinergic and GABAergic terminals. GlyT1 is abundant in neocortex, thalamus and hippocampus, where it is expressed in astrocytes, and involved in glutamatergic neurotransmission. GlyT1 and GlyT2, which are located in glial cells and neurons, respectively play important roles by clearing synaptically released glycine or supplying glycine to glycinergic neurons to regulate glycinergic neurotransmission. Thus, inhibition of GlyTs could be used to modify pain signal transmission in the spinal cord.

Sarcosine
0 ImagesSarcosine (N-Methylglycine), an endogenous amino acid, is a competitive glycine transporter type I (GlyT1) inhibitor and N-methyl-D-aspartate (NMDA) receptor co-agonist. Sarcosine increases the glycine concentration, resulting in an indirect potentiation of the NMDA receptor. Sarcosine is commonly used for the research of schizophrenia. -

N-Arachidonylglycine
0 ImagesSynonyms: NA-GlyN-Arachidonylglycine (NA-Gly), a carboxylic analog of the endocannabinoid anandamide (AEA), is a GPR18 agonist (EC50 = 44.5 nM). Unlike AEA, N-Arachidonylglycine has no activity at either CB1 or CB2 receptors. N-Arachidonylglycine inhibits GLYT2 (IC50 = 5.1 μM). N-Arachidonylglycine also is an effective activator of endometrial cell migration. -

Stearoylcarnitine
0 ImagesStearoylcarnitine, a fatty ester lipid molecule, is an endogenous metabolite. Stearoylcarnitine can be used as PKC inhibitor. Stearoylcarnitine accumulates in β cells, leading to arrest of insulin synthesis and energy deficiency in type 2 diabetes mouse. Stearoylcarnitine inhibits lecithin cholesterol acyltransferase (LCAT) in rat and rabbits plasma. Stearoylcarnitine acts as a metabolomics biomarker for Parkinson’s disease. Stearoylcarnitine is a less potent inhibitor of GlyT2. -

RPI-GLYT2-82
0 ImagesCat. No.: HY-181977RPI-GLYT2-82 is a reversible, blood-brain barrier-permeable allosteric inhibitor of GlyT2 with an IC50 value of 554 nM. RPI-GLYT2-82 also exhibits inhibitory activity against 5-HT2AR and SERT, with IC50 values of 1.9 μM and 4.7 μM, respectively. RPI-GLYT2-82 inhibits pain signals and alleviates allodynia, shows no target-related side effects at the maximum analgesic dose, and has no addictive potential. RPI-GLYT2-82 can be used for the research of neuropathic pain. -

GLyT2-IN-3
0 ImagesCat. No.: HY-184901CAS No.: 2789716-24-9GLyT2-IN-3 is a potent GlyT2 inhibitor with a KD of 23.7 nM. GLyT2-IN-3 inhibits GlyT2-mediated glycine uptake with an IC50 of 19.4 nM. GLyT2-IN-3 shows broad-spectrum antinociceptive effects in three pain models, does not induce sedative effects or motor coordination impairment in mice, and exhibits favorable pharmacokinetic properties in rats with an oral bioavailability of 88.57%, GLyT2-IN-3 can be used for the study of neuropathic pain. -

Org 24461
0 ImagesCat. No.: HY-182484CAS No.: 372198-80-6Org 24461 is a selective and brain-penetrant GlyT-1 inhibitor. Org 24461 blocks glycine uptake, reuptake, reverse operation, [3H]glycine efflux and release. Org 24461 enhances NMDA receptor function, modulates striatal monoamine/glutamate levels, and reverses PCP-induced behavioral and electrographic abnormalities. Org 24461 can be used for the research of retinal hypoxia/ischemia, and schizophrenia. -

Opiranserin hydrochloride
0 ImagesSynonyms: VVZ-149 hydrochlorideOpiranserin (VVZ-149) hydrochloride, a non-opioid and non-NSAID analgesic candidate, is a dual antagonist of glycine transporter type 2 (GlyT2) and serotonin receptor 2A (5HT2A), with IC50s of 0.86 and 1.3 μM, respectively. Opiranserin hydrochloride shows antagonistic activity on rP2X3 (IC50=0.87 μM). Opiranserin hydrochloride is development as an injectable agent for the treatment of postoperative pain. -
